Dispensers+ v10 (Beta 1.5_01)
Compatible with ModLoader.
Modifies dispensers to:
Drop boats and minecarts
Place (or shoot*) TNT
"Use" water/lava buckets
Drop contents when destroyed
Store minecarts** and boats on collision
* Dispensers will shoot TNT if they are placed on top of an iron block.
** Please note that any items contained in a cart will be dropped before the dispenser picks up the cart. Installation Instructions
If you use ModLoader make sure to install this mod last!
A note about the alt. version: Due to a bug in Minecraft, I had to shrink the dispenser's collision box in order to detect minecarts/boats colliding with the dispenser. Unfortunately, this can cause TNT to get stuck (see this post). If you plan to use this mod to make cannons, you'll need to download the alt. version instead of the normal one.

RespawnBeds Test Version (Beta 1.3_01)
This mod makes beds act as spawn points. When you die you will respawn at the nearest bed.
Some quick notes:
This is a test version. If you aren't interested in testing it, you'll probably want to wait until a stable version is released. Use at your own risk!
You must place your beds after installing this mod for respawning to work. Beds placed before this mod is installed must be rebuilt to act as a spawn point.
Due to how bed positions are saved ATM (in level.dat), if you uninstall this mod the next time you start Minecraft all bed spawn points will be lost.
The compass does not point to the nearest bed; it still points to your original spawn point.

New version of Dispensers+ up. Dispensers can now "use" water and lava buckets. If the dispenser finds a water/lava bucket, it replaces the bucket with an empty one and drops the appropriate source block in front of it. If the dispenser has an empty bucket it will scoop up any source block directly in front of it.
